PIN Code 534211 – West Godavari, Andhra Pradesh

We found a total of 5 post offices linked with the postal code 534211. This PIN Code is associated with West Godavari district of Andhra Pradesh in India. The first digit of ZIP Code 534211 i.e. 5 represents the region Andhra Pradesh, the second digit 3 denotes the sub-region Vijayawada Region and the third digit 4 indicates the sorting-district West Godavari.

What is a DIGIPIN?

DIGIPIN is India Post's free Digital PIN: a 10-character code that pinpoints any location to a ~4-metre square. Find the DIGIPIN of your current location, or decode a DIGIPIN to see it on the map.
